Hello to all,I have designed a Single ended LNA for 5.2GHz with Fmin of 2.3dB.But at the output i am getting only 4dB gain that is S21 value.Please tell me the procedure how to improve it to get 17dB.

But i have to use only CMOS transistor and i don't have chance to use any other design components.
 

Re: LNA gain improvement

then you can use two-stages for achieve 17dB gain, the 1st stage should have less NF and gain about 8~10dB, and 2nd stage should have more gain and higher NF.
